Is UltraVPN Legitimate?

UltraVPN is a legitimate company owned by the Pango Group, a cybersecurity company that specializes in security services and consumer identity protection. It offers comprehensive features for secure and private browsing.

Who is the Owner of UltraVPN?

UltraVPN is owned and operated by Aura, a Pango Group company. Aura believes in providing secure and private internet access to everyone, regardless of their situation.

Is UltraVPN Free?

UltraVPN does not offer free trials, but it does provide a 30-day money-back guarantee for all subscription plans. During this period, you can cancel your subscription and request a refund if you are not satisfied.

Who is UltraVPN?

UltraVPN is a privacy-focused VPN service that prioritizes user security. It utilizes the OpenVPN protocol with AES-256 encryption, offers its own DNS servers, features a kill switch, and boasts a strict no-logs policy.

What is the Catch of Free VPNs?

Free VPNs often come with limitations and potential risks:

  • Data selling: Free VPNs may sell your data to third parties
  • Malware: Some free VPNs may contain harmful malware
  • Speed and data limits: Free VPNs are generally slower and impose data usage restrictions

Can They Track Me If I Use a VPN?

A premium quality VPN encrypts your data and hides your IP address, making it difficult for anyone to track your online activities. However, it’s important to note that certain information you provide to websites and services you log into can still be tracked.

Is it legal to use a VPN to save money

Outside of China, Russia, UAE, and some other countries that have banned the use of VPNs, using a VPN is usually completely legal. However, purchasing services or goods with VPNs might be against the terms of service of the company you are buying from. Before you make any purchases, always check the terms of service.

Do free VPNs sell your info

Since you're not paying for a VPN subscription with real money, free VPNs have other ways to benefit from you. One of them is collecting and selling your data. Some free VPNs may collect data such as browsing history, search queries, IP address, and location, then sell that data to advertisers or other third parties.

Should I trust free VPN

Free VPNs simply aren't as safe

Because to maintain the hardware and expertise needed for large networks and secure users, VPN services have expensive bills to pay. As a VPN customer, you either pay for a premium VPN service with your dollars or you pay for free services with your data.

Are free VPNs illegal

In most jurisdictions, the use of VPNs is legal. Some countries such as the U.S. and the U.K. allow citizens to use these tools to protect their online privacy and access geo-restricted content. In contrast, many countries ban VPNs as part of broader efforts to control internet access and suppress dissenting voices.

Can the police track a VPN

With a VPN on, the user's online activities and data are encrypted. But, if the VPN software has security flaws and vulnerabilities, the police (or any other third party, for that matter) can use them to “break into” the VPN and see what data is being sent and received. So technically, the policy could track a VPN.
